MundoGEOConnect 2013 megatrends seminar: Experts discuss about new prospect of the geospatial data. In June, several geospatial industry experts will discuss the main novelties and changes about the use of the geospatial data in society. The event takes place in June 18th, at the Frei Caneca Convention Center, in Sao Paulo (SP), during the MundoGEO # Connect LatinAmerica 2013 – Conference and Trade Fair for Geomatics and Geospatial Solutions Representatives of large companies, such as the Google, and several international institutions, will attend the event.

“The geospatial sector lives in an era of intense changes, with new technologies becoming reality, and changing the way how people seek and visualize the data”, affirms Alexandre Scussel, Editorial Assessor of MundoGEO. “Last year, MundoGEO# Connect event presented the geospatial trends for the upcoming years, and once again, in 2013, it is bringing representatives of important institutions and companies to pinpoint the future of geotechnologies”, he concluded.

Megatrends seminar will start at 8:30am, along with the official opening of MundoGEO#Connect LatinAmerica 2013. The first group of lectures, in the morning, will be about the Infrastructures Spatial Data (IDEs), both international and national.

The president of one of the most important institutions in the sector, the Global Spatial Date Infrastructure (GSDI), as well as a representative of Open Geospatial Consortium (OGC), another important international geospatial entity of the sector, will attend the event.

In this seminar, it will also be discussed the challenges of mobile, cloud and big data in organizations; and Rural Environmental Registry (CAR), in a lecture that will show the revolution of geoinformation in the field and in the middle environment, carried out by Izabella Teixeira, minister of Environment in Brazil. The future of Global Systems Positioning will also be discussed (GNSS); and Registration and Geospatial Data Infrastructure in the Americas, in a session that will feature representatives of important geospatial organizations of America Latina.

All lectures of the MegaTrends seminar will have simultaneous translation into English, Spanish and Portuguese.
